Overview
CARTO
CARTO transforms how you interact with spatial data by bringing analytics directly into your cloud data warehouse. Instead of moving massive datasets to external tools, you can perform complex geospatial analysis natively within environments like Snowflake, BigQuery, or Redshift. This approach ensures your data remains secure and up-to-date while providing the processing power needed for large-scale spatial operations.
You can build interactive maps and data applications using a library of pre-built components and SQL-based workflows. Whether you are optimizing delivery routes, selecting new retail locations, or monitoring environmental changes, the platform provides the spatial functions and visualization tools to turn coordinates into business strategy. It is designed for data scientists, analysts, and developers who need to scale their geographic insights without the overhead of traditional desktop GIS software.
VU.CITY
VU.CITY provides you with a highly accurate 3D digital environment to transform how you plan and develop urban projects. By using survey-grade 3D models, you can drop your proposed designs directly into a virtual city to see exactly how they impact the skyline, sunlight, and surrounding views. It removes the guesswork from the planning process by giving you a shared, data-rich environment where all stakeholders can visualize the future of a site before a single brick is laid.
You can use the platform to conduct instant visibility studies, analyze overshadowing, and test multiple design iterations in real-time. Whether you are an architect, developer, or planning officer, the software helps you identify potential issues early, reducing project risk and speeding up the path to planning consent. It currently covers major cities across the UK and internationally, providing a consistent scale for complex urban decision-making.

CARTO Features
- Analytics Toolbox Access over 100 advanced spatial functions directly in your data warehouse using standard SQL for complex geographic analysis.
- CARTO Builder Create professional, interactive maps and spatial reports using a web-based interface that requires no specialized GIS training.
- Data Observatory Enrich your internal data with thousands of public and premium spatial datasets including demographics, weather, and human mobility.
- Cloud Native Integration Connect seamlessly to BigQuery, Snowflake, Redshift, and Databricks to analyze your data where it already lives.
- Spatial SQL Use familiar SQL syntax to perform spatial joins, clustering, and geocoding without exporting data to external applications.
- App Framework Build custom geospatial applications quickly using developer-friendly libraries and pre-built UI components for rapid deployment.
VU.CITY Features
- Accurate 3D City Models. Access survey-grade 3D models of entire cities with 15cm accuracy to place your designs in a precise digital context.
- Real-Time Shadow Analysis. Toggle the sun's position at any time of day or year to instantly see how your building impacts local light.
- Verified View Studies. Generate accurate visual representations from specific coordinates to understand how your development looks from street level or protected viewpoints.
- BIM Integration. Import your 3D models directly from Revit, Rhino, or SketchUp to see your detailed designs inside the city model.
- Zoning and Massing Tools. Create simple 3D shapes to test different building heights and volumes before committing to a detailed architectural design.
- Collaborative Cloud Platform. Share your 3D scenes with clients and planners via a web browser to facilitate faster feedback and approvals.
